Understanding Three-Bedroom House Plans

A three-bedroom house plan is one of the most versatile and popular home designs available.

It offers enough room for a family while maintaining a manageable square footage and construction cost.

Whether designed for a single-story, multi-family, open-concept layout, or DIY three bedroom house plans, these plans can be adapted to different architectural styles.

This includes unique designs such as Cape Cod, Contemporary Design, Modern House Plans, or Simple House Plans.

Key Features of Three-Bedroom House Plans:

  • Flexible Bedroom Layouts – Typically includes a master suite and secondary bedrooms. These can be converted into a guest room, hobby room, or home office.

  • Varied Home Designs – Available in split-bedroom, open floor plan, and traditional layouts.

  • Functional Living Spaces – Can include a great room, family room, dining area, and formal living room.

  • Efficient Use of Space – Options for storage space, additional bathrooms, and energy-efficient features.

  • Foundation and Structure Choices – Built on crawl space, slab, or daylight basement foundations.

How to Modify a Stock Plan for Personal Needs

Accurate cost estimation for three-bedroom house plans helps you design a space that meets your needs while staying within budget.

In fact, our stock house plans provide an excellent starting point, but many homeowners require customizations to fit their specific needs.

Modifying a three-bedroom home plan ensures the home suits a homeowner’s lifestyle, budget, and future growth.

Steps to Modifying a Stock House Plan:

  1. Assess Your Lifestyle Needs – Consider how much square footage is necessary, whether you need an exercise room, additional storage, or a larger home.

  2. Adjust Bedroom Floor Plans – Convert secondary bedrooms into a home office, guest room, or playroom.

  3. Expand Living Spaces – Create an open floor plan by removing walls between the kitchen, dining, and family rooms.

  4. Increase Energy Efficiency – Incorporate energy-efficient windows, solar panels, and insulation to reduce energy costs.

  5. Modify Structural Features – Adjust the foundation type, square foot layout, and construction materials based on budget and climate conditions.

Adding Extra Bathrooms, Home Offices, and Storage Spaces

Additional Bathrooms

Many standard three-bedroom home plans include two bathrooms.

However, for added convenience, homeowners often customize plans to include half bathrooms, ensuite baths, or Jack-and-Jill layouts.

Bath features like double sinks, walk-in showers, and soaking tubs can also enhance a primary suite.

Home Offices and Hobby Rooms

With the rise of remote work, a dedicated home office is a crucial addition.

Some homeowners opt to convert an extra bedroom, build an office near the main floor, or even add a separate exercise room or hobby room.

Increasing Storage Space

Homeowners often customize house plans to add walk-in closets, mudrooms, built-in shelving, and expanded garages.

Garage bays can be designed to accommodate extra vehicles, workshops, or storage.

Choosing the Right Foundation & Structure Type

Foundation Types

  • Crawl Space – Offers flexibility for maintenance and insulation.

  • Daylight Basement – Ideal for sloped lots and adding extra space.

  • Slab Foundation – Cost-effective and suitable for warm climates.

Structure Types

Choosing the right structure type impacts the construction cost and overall home durability.

Homeowners should consider factors such as sq. ft. plans, structural efficiency, and long-term maintenance costs.

Enhancing Outdoor & Energy-Efficient Features

Outdoor Living Areas

Customizing a home often includes incorporating rear porches, outdoor fireplaces, or patio seating areas.

These features enhance living space and improve a home’s resale value.

Energy Efficiency Enhancements

  • Improving insulation to lower energy costs

  • Upgrading windows and doors to be energy-efficient

  • Using sustainable building materials
